Micromax has announced its first smartphone of the month, the Canvas Xpress, priced at Rs. 6,999. The smartphone will be exclusively available on Flipkart starting December 8.

The Micromax Canvas Xpress runs Android 4.4.2 KitKat out-of-the-box and offers dual-SIM (GSM+GSM) functionality. It features a 4.5-inch FWVGA (480x854 pixel) display and is powered by a 1.3GHz quad-core (unspecified) processor coupled with 1GB of RAM.

The primary camera on the Micromax Canvas Xpress has a 5-megapixel resolution and flash, while there is also a 0.3-megapixel front facing camera onboard. The internal storage on the Canvas Xpress is not yet mentioned, though it can be expanded via microSD card (up to 32GB).

The device's connectivity options are also not mentioned. A 1950mAh battery backs the Canvas Xpress. Micromax also announced Aircel users can avail 500MB of free mobile Internet data per month for the first six months on their Canvas Xpress smartphones.

The Canvas Xpress also features preloaded apps like HotKnot (MediaTek's NFC-like solution) and Smart Wake. With the former, users can tap screen-to-screen for sharing images, videos, music and browsing URLs. With Smart Wake the Canvas Xpress users can open apps with customised gestures directly from the lockscreen.
